Mendoza Vows Growth After Raiders Preseason Debut

TL;DR Summary
Rookie Fernando Mendoza, the Raiders’ No. 1 pick in 2026, showed promise in his NFL preseason debut with four drives, going 10-of-16 for 97 yards and throwing a TD to Jack Bech in a 27-14 loss to Arizona. He acknowledged he must grow, citing the faster pro defenses and the higher autonomy in the NFL, and said he’ll study the game film tonight. Coach Klint Kubiak praised his growth and indicated Kirk Cousins remains the preseason starter, with Mendoza expected to be brought along slowly before he potentially starts, with another game set for Aug. 20 against the Texans.
